The Operations and IT Management Department in the Richard A. Chaifetz School of Business, Saint Louis University is seeking applicants for a tenure-track Assistant Professor position. JOB DUTIES Teach supply chain management and business analytic courses at undergraduate and/or graduate level (45%), conduct high quality research (45%), student advising (5%), and university service (5%). MINIMUM QUALIFICATIONS PhD in Business Administration with emphasis in Operations Management, Management Science, Business Analytics, or related area, or PhD in an emphasis area (can be foreign equivalent). Proficiency in mathematical modeling and optimization, strong teaching skills, and record of academic research. Applicants should submit a cover letter, curriculum vitae, three letters of reference, research statement, and teaching statement including prior teaching evaluations.
